DSIV ACTIVE USER (3326)    REMOTE PROCEDURE (8994)

Name Value
NAME DSIV ACTIVE USER
TAG ACT
ROUTINE DSIVDUZ
RETURN VALUE TYPE SINGLE VALUE
AVAILABILITY AGREEMENT
DESCRIPTION
This will determine if a user (DUZ value) is valid and is active.  Also,
 additionally screening logic can be passed in to validate a user.
INPUT PARAMETER
  • XDUZ
    PARAMETER TYPE:   LITERAL
    MAXIMUM DATA LENGTH:   15
    REQUIRED:   YES
    SEQUENCE NUMBER:   1
    DESCRIPTION:   
    This is a pointer value to the NEW PERSON file.
    
  • DSISCR
    PARAMETER TYPE:   LIST
    MAXIMUM DATA LENGTH:   250
    REQUIRED:   NO
    SEQUENCE NUMBER:   2
    DESCRIPTION:   
    You may pass additional screening criteria to be checked.  For a user to
     be returned, all screening criteria must be true in addition to being
     Active.
     
     Allowable formats of DSISCR(n) = flag^val1^val2^val3^..
       check for security key    KEY^security key name
       check for parameter       PARM^ parameter name^parameter instance
       execute M code
         M^<return message>^<executable M code which sets $T>
    
RETURN PARAMETER DESCRIPTION
If user isf found and is active, then return the user's DUZ value.
 Else return -1^message.
